An afternoon with trumpeter Brandon Woody
by Lawrence Burney
Released November 28 in The Baltimore Banner

Excerpt: Throughout an intense, initial-of-the-calendar year chilly entrance in mid-November, Brandon Woody is soaking up every ounce of warmth in his Southwest Baltimore residing space. He’s in a white T-shirt, sweats and black Crocs lounging with his homie, musician Briley Harris, and Woody’s dog, Marley, but confesses that he should really be paying out this idle time doing the job at his craft.

You may possibly or may well not have noticed Woody close to town on competition stages, on a Calvin Klein billboard shot by SHAN Wallace or entertaining a wine glass-gripping crowd at the Eubie Blake’s courtyard. Which is because around the previous few of a long time, the 24-yr-aged trumpeter has made some significant strides in his occupation.

In February, he was booked to provide the tunes for a Nike sneaker release in New York City’s SoHo district. In September he and his band, UPENDO, had a weeklong residency at the University of Maryland, University Park’s accomplishing arts heart, The Clarice, for their Browsing Artist Sequence. And, perhaps most shiny of all, he was solid as a musician in the forthcoming Apple Television set Baltimore-primarily based sequence, ”Lady in the Lake.”
